This service funds both education and practice costs for the insertion of ring pessaries.
This service is part of the Advanced Primary Options programme.
Your Pinnacle Services Contract applies to this service. By claiming for this service, you have indicated that you have read and agreed to the business rules set out here.
This is NOT a clinical guideline.
All Pinnacle practices in the Waikato region can claim for this service, provided they have suitably trained staff able to perform the required procedure.
This programme is also funded for patients not enrolled in your practice, who may be referred to you via another service/practice. In these cases, you can only invoice for this service and no other off set can be claimed.
If you are not able to provide this procedure for your patients, this care can be provided by another practice in your area. This can be arranged by direct contact between you and the other practice. The practice performing the procedure will invoice Pinnacle directly and there will still be no cost to the patient.
Referral for physiotherapy pelvic floor training should also be considered.
Please make your claim via Primary Options, select Ring Pessary and then attach the appropriate invoice(s).
Ring pessary consultation: $81.37
Consultation for fitting/insertion/change of pessary. This invoice is a package of care, it includes an allocation for staff time as well as consumables and cannot be claimed along with any other claims.
Pessaries can be ordered via BPAC - select Enhanced Primary Care: Gynaecology - Ring Pessary Order. The pessaries will be couriered to your practice.
Ring pessary education: $500
One off payment for education attendance at Ring Pessary Clinic Waikato Hospital for any clinical practice staff. This will involve attendance at an outpatient clinic training day. Bookings for this education can be made via Gynaecology Clinic Waikato Hospital 07 839 8899 ext 96733, or email Tracey.Williams2@waikatodhb.health.nz
This is claimed via the Primary Options team- please email infoprimaryoptions@pinnacle.health.nz with the details of staff attending training.

Practices are required to provide sufficiently detailed consultation notes to determine appropriate use of funding.
It has been recommended that in addition to a good assessment and history, the eligibility criteria are clearly stated in the clinical notes.
There is no charge to the patient for this service.
The service is funded by Te Whatu Ora.
